      <description>I’m not related to any member of this family.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;1940 is the last available census at this time. &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Facts you should know about the early census records -&lt;br&gt;All census records [1790 – 1840] prior to the 1850 census ONLY listed the head of household; whether male or female. &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;NO specific age was stated for any family member&lt;br&gt;NO place of birth was stated – city, state, or country &lt;br&gt;NO city, town, or village is stated – only the county; however some census takers listed the township&lt;br&gt;NO street address was stated&lt;br&gt;NO marital status was stated – single, married, widowed, or divorced&lt;br&gt;NO family relationship was stated – brother, sister, cousin, son, daughter, wife, inlaw, etc…&lt;br&gt;NO occupation was stated&lt;br&gt;NO parental birthplaces are stated			&lt;br&gt;NO race was stated [but assume “white”] &lt;br&gt;	&lt;br&gt;1850, 1860 &amp;amp; 1870 census records do not show family relationships, marital status or parental birthplaces.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Step children are not enumerated as “step” children&lt;br&gt;Adopted children are not enumerated as “adopted”&lt;br&gt;Grand children are not enumerated as “grand children”&lt;br&gt;Orphaned children were not enumerated as "orphan"&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;1850 is the 1st census that shows all family members &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;1880 is the 1st census that shows parental birthplaces and family relationships +++&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Wisconsin, Births and Christenings Index, 1826-1908 &lt;br&gt;Name: Watson Adelbert Davidson &lt;br&gt;Birth Date: 4 Jun 1865 &lt;br&gt;Birth Place: Berlin, Green Lake, Wisconsin &lt;br&gt;Gender: Male &lt;br&gt;Race: White &lt;br&gt;Father's Name: James Madison Davidson &lt;br&gt;Father's Birth Place: Battleborough, Vermont &lt;br&gt;Mother's Name: Achsah Castor &lt;br&gt;Mother's Birth Place: Syracuse, New York &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;1860 -&lt;br&gt;Name: Achsah Daraielsen&lt;br&gt;[Achsah Davidson]  &lt;br&gt;Age in 1860: 32 &lt;br&gt;Birth Year: abt 1828 &lt;br&gt;Birthplace: New York &lt;br&gt;Home in 1860: Berlin, Green Lake, Wisconsin &lt;br&gt;Gender: Female &lt;br&gt;Post Office: Berlin &lt;br&gt; &lt;br&gt;Banres Daraielsen 46, VT - farmer &lt;br&gt;Achsah Daraielsen 32, NY &lt;br&gt;Elizabeth Daraielsen 14, NY &lt;br&gt;Henry Daraielsen 12, NY &lt;br&gt;Mary Daraielsen 9, WI &lt;br&gt;James Daraielsen 7, WI &lt;br&gt;Achsah Daraielsen 6, WI [1854]&lt;br&gt;Minnie Daraielsen 1, WI&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t; &lt;br&gt;1870-&lt;br&gt;Davidson family is not listed.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Don't you have the marriage relationship BACKWARDS?&lt;br&gt;Achsah Davidson's brother was James DAVIDSON and not James Castor&lt;br&gt; &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t; &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;</description>

      <description>Hello, this doesn't seem to be the Thomas Hamilton you are looking for. RP&lt;br&gt;------------&lt;br&gt;Stevens Point Daily Journal | Stevens Point, Wisconsin | Wednesday, October 21, 1903 | Page 1&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Suicide at Westfield.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;   Thomas Hamilton of Westfield, a young man 23 years of age, a brother of Miss Nellie Hamilton, who formerly attended the Normal, shot himself through the head Tuesday morning, producing instant death. Hie had been in ill health for some time and his people wanted him to go to a hospital for treatment. He got a notion that they intended to take him to an asylum, and when his uncle came to&lt;br&gt;take him away he ran upstairs and shot himself.</description>
